2023 年原油市場規模價值 7,398.8 億美元,預計將從 2024 年的 7,517.2 億美元成長到 2032 年的 8,535.0 億美元,預測期內(2025-2032 年)的複合年成長率為 1.6%。

近期全球原油市場的動態凸顯了供需之間的重要交互作用,對價格波動有重大影響。影響供應的關鍵因素包括地緣政治事件、主要產油國的決定、環境惡化。相反,需求將受到新興市場趨勢、工業活動、經濟成長和不斷變化的交通需求(尤其是電動車的快速普及)的影響。 OPEC透過成員國之間的合作在穩定產量和價格方面發揮著至關重要的作用,但美國頁岩油產量和非OPEC國家的貢獻對市場趨勢也有額外的影響。此外,對更清潔替代能源的支持日益增多,推動了向可再生能源的轉變,並反映了世界對環境永續性日益成長的承諾。這些不斷變化的情況可能會繼續重塑石油產業。

Crude Oil Market size was valued at USD 739.88 bill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 751.72 billion in 2024 to USD 853.5 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 1.6% during the forecast period (2025-2032).

Recent dynamics within the global crude oil market highlight the crucial interplay between supply and demand, markedly influencing price volatility. Key factors affecting supply include geopolitical events, decisions from major oil-producing nations, and environmental disruptions. Conversely, demand is shaped by emerging market trends, industrial activity, economic growth, and shifting transportation needs, notably the surge in electric vehicle adoption. OPEC plays a pivotal role in stabilizing production levels and prices through collaboration among its member states, while the U.S. shale oil production and non-OPEC contributions further impact market trends. Additionally, increasing advocacy for cleaner energy alternatives is driving a transition towards renewable sources, reflecting a growing global commitment to environmental sustainability. This evolving landscape will continue to reshape the oil industry in the coming years.

Driver of the Crude Oil Market

The crude oil market is largely influenced by geopolitical events, as tensions in crucial oil-producing regions disrupt supply chains and lead to price fluctuations. Decisions made by major oil-producing nations, especially those within the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C), play a significant role in global supply dynamics. Additionally, the rivalry between OPEC and non-OPEC producers, with the U.S. shale oil production being particularly prominent, further impacts the supply-demand equilibrium. These factors create a complex landscape where political stability, production levels, and competition among various producer countries shape the overall behavior of crude oil prices in the marketplace.

Restraints in the Crude Oil Market

The crude oil market faces several significant restraints, particularly due to geopolitical uncertainties and conflicts in key oil-producing areas, which disrupt supply chains and lead to increased market volatility. Additionally, heightened environmental concerns and the implementation of strict regulations aimed at decreasing carbon emissions and fostering sustainable practices pose considerable challenges for the conventional fossil fuel sector. Furthermore, the demand for crude oil is subject to fluctuations driven by economic downturns and a growing transition towards renewable energy sources, resulting in an unstable market dynamic that complicates long-term planning and investment in the industry.

Market Trends of the Crude Oil Market

The crude oil market is experiencing a transformative shift due to the rising emphasis on environmental sustainability, propelled by global initiatives aimed at reducing carbon emissions. As nations prioritize renewable energy sources and cleaner alternatives, the long-term demand for traditional crude oil is poised to decline. Concurrently, the industry is embracing technological innovations, such as advanced extraction techniques, digitalization, and automation, which are enhancing operational efficiency and reducing costs. Geopolitical dynamics remain a significant factor, with evolving alliances and production agreements continually affecting global supply chains, thereby creating a complex landscape for traders and investors navigating the crude oil market.
